To determine which reaction will most likely take place, it's essential to consider the reactants involved, their properties, and the reaction conditions. Typically, reactions that are thermodynamically favorable, such as those that lead to increased stability or lower energy states, are more likely to occur. Additionally, factors like concentration, temperature, and the presence of catalysts can influence the likelihood of a reaction taking place. Without specific details about the reactants or conditions, it's challenging to predict the exact reaction.
